Christmas arrived early, and winter ready, for a Shuswap mother and daughter thanks to several Salmon Arm businesses.
香蕉视频直播淚 felt like I was going to pass out,香蕉视频直播 commented an excited Billie Jean on Friday morning, Dec. 20, after learning she would be the 2019 recipient of 2nd annual Shuswap Christmas Car Giveaway.
The vehicle, a 2009 Dodge Caravan, came complete with a full set of new winter tires and a cargo area loaded with gifts.

Braby Motors provided the van, Fix Auto took care of the body work, while Kal Tire looked after the mechanical work and provided the winter tires. On top of that, Jean received $1,500 worth of insurance paid for by SASCU.

Jean said the new vehicle will be especially beneficial for her daughter Frankie who uses a wheelchair.

Jean was selected to received the van after the participating businesses put out a call for nominations, seeking a deserving family whose transportation needs would be better met with the minivan.
